The Global Pharmaceutical Inspection Machines Market is hindered by the high cost of compliance with stringent regulatory standards. For instance, the average compliance cost for FDA regulations can reach up to 20% of total production expenses, adding significant financial pressure on pharmaceutical companies. For example, small manufacturers may find it challenging to invest adequately in state-of-the-art inspection equipment due to escalating operational costs, which could constrain their market presence.
A notable trend is the growing adoption of AI-based systems in inspection machinery. Companies like Siemens Healthineers are deploying machine learning algorithms that analyze detection data, aiming for near-zero error rates in defect identification. These systems, implemented in 2023, enable manufacturers to detect anomalies in real-time, thereby reducing wastage and production downtime. Another trend involves the expansion of automated visual inspection capabilities, which is projected to enhance operational efficiency by up to 30% by 2026, making processes faster and less labor-intensive.
The move towards personalized medicine presents lucrative revenue opportunities within this market. Companies are developing compact inspection machines tailored for custom pharmaceuticals. For example, ACG Worldwide has focused on creating portable inspection units capable of handling variable product sizes, responding to forecasts indicating a 20% rise in demand for personalized medications by 2030. Additionally, the increasing need for consistent quality in emerging markets indicates a strong potential for investment in inspection technologies, especially as these nations enhance regulatory frameworks.
As of 2025, Automated Visual Inspection machines lead the market with an estimated share of ~38%. This dominance is attributed to their efficiency in processing high volumes while ensuring stringent quality standards. Conversely, Leak Testing Machines are expected to be the fastest-growing segment, projected to grow at a CAGR of 9.1% from 2026 to 2032. The demand for these machines stems from the increasing focus on product leak integrity in drug packaging.
Optical Inspection leads the market, commanding a share of approximately 40% as of 2025. This method’s effectiveness in detecting packaging and product defects keeps it at the forefront. Meanwhile, High-Speed Cameras are anticipated to see the fastest growth, with a CAGR of 8.2% from 2026 to 2032. Their capability to capture high-resolution images at rapid speeds is becoming essential in high-volume manufacturing settings.
AI-Based Image Recognition currently dominates the technology segment, accounting for around 30% share in 2025. This approach enhances defect detection accuracy, making it a preferred choice among manufacturers. Conversely, X-Ray Detection is on a trajectory to grow at a CAGR of 8.9% from 2026 to 2032, driven by its increasing applications in ensuring safety from hidden defects in product packaging.
Parenteral Drug Inspection is the largest application segment, holding a share of roughly 35% in 2025, due to the critical nature of sterility in injectable medications. Meanwhile, Liquid Drug Solutions are expected to grow at a CAGR of 8.5% from 2026 to 2032, reflecting trends towards more liquid-based pharmaceuticals that require precise inspection protocols.
Pharma Companies lead the market, possessing an estimated share of 50% as of 2025, being major adopters of inspection technologies due to regulatory compliance needs. However, Contract Manufacturing Organizations (CMOs & CDMOs) are projected to grow fastest at a CAGR of 10.2% from 2026 to 2032, driven by their increasing workload and partnership with pharmaceutical entities.
North America remains the largest region in the Global Pharmaceutical Inspection Machines Market, making up approximately 45% share as of 2025, attributed to its strong pharmaceutical sector and established regulatory framework. Conversely, the Asia region is forecasted to experience the fastest growth, with a CAGR of 9.5% from 2026 to 2032, largely due to rising pharmaceutical production capacities and increasing healthcare investments.

The competitive structure of the Global Pharmaceutical Inspection Machines Market remains somewhat fragmented, with numerous players leveraging specialized capabilities to carve out market share. Players like GE Healthcare and Siemens Healthineers hold significant influence due to their technological leadership and broad product portfolios, while emerging companies also make strides through niche innovations.
| Leading Company | Core Strength | Strategic Focus |
|---|---|---|
| GE Healthcare | Deep expertise in imaging technology | AI-driven solutions for enhanced inspection |
| Siemens Healthineers | Robust digital health ecosystem | Integration of machine learning in inspection |
| Metronic | Broad range of inspection technologies | Focus on optical and leak testing machines |
| Rockwell Automation | Strength in industrial automation solutions | Emphasis on AI for predictive maintenance |
| ACG Worldwide | Expertise in pharmaceutical packaging machinery | Development of portable inspection solutions |
In summary, while leading players dominate the market due to their advanced technologies and established reputations, emerging entities are also making meaningful contributions, driving an ongoing evolution in inspection processes and capabilities.
